For more than 80 years, Safran Seats has been a premium manufacturer of First and Business Class seating systems for passenger airlines. With the largest seats portfolio of all seats suppliers, we pride ourselves on innovation, customization, quality and industrial design. Safran Seats GB, based in Cwmbran, South Wales is a 100% owned subsidiary of Safran Seats and we currently have 800+ employees (across 3 sites in the UK- Cwmbran, Newport and Brackley). An Engineering Project Lead is a senior and key role at Safran. It requires an excellent project manager and a real problem solver - a go-to natural leader in the team. A strong communicator with the ability to converse at all levels is essential to succeed. Managing across a functional matrix structure within the Technical Domain of the business, your responsibility is focused on effective planning and execution of engineering projects to meet or exceed the agreed performance metrics. You will be the Technical focal point for the project under your responsibility, across the entire business and also Customer and Airframer facing. Key Responsibilities

Supporting the IPT in identifying project risk, mitigation actions and contingency plans Supporting the development of project plans, schedules and budgets Tracking progress of project tasks across multi-functional engineering teams Resolving schedule conflict and developing technical solutions with inputs from the Technical Functional teams, ensuring high levels of quality deliverables Providing a clear project status both internally and to the customer Tracking performance against budget for NRC and RC Ensuring effective management of large work packages across the group business units or with partners Liaising with the customer to present technical solutions and their impact on programme schedule Collating inputs to generate and maintain customer product specifications, creating and maintaining coherent work breakdown structures Managing technical requirements relevant to your project scope, through a systems engineering approach, tracking technical changes Participating in Design Reviews throughout each phase of the New Product Introduction process Job requirements

HNC/HND within a related Engineering discipline is essential Engineering Degree within an Aerospace related discipline desirable Previous experience managing multi-functional teams including within a remote working setting A good understanding of the certification framework within which the work is undertaken, preferably with some knowledge of Aircraft Interiors An awareness of configuration management principles and change management processes Experienced in preparation of business cases or bids for new programmes including Technical specification preparation desirable An understanding of financial management within a new product development environment, dealing with different categories of costs that are both internal and external to the business Product development and associated processes Systems Engineering (Requirements Engineering, MBSE, Functional design) Mechanical, electrical and systems design Do you want to join our team?
